"Motteke! Sailor Fuku Re-mix 001 -7 Burning Remixers" Will Burn Your Soul
by Zac Bentz, 08/28/2007

"Motteke! Sailor Fuku Re-mix 001 -7 Burning Remixers" is, obviously, a remix album featuring the Lucky Star OP "Motteke! Sailor Fuku." The styles range from crazy fast para para techno to slightly slower but no less crazy para para style techno.

OK, so maybe that's overstating things a bit. There is actually a range of dance styles, but maybe it's just that is seems like the remixers couldn't help but make an already critically annoying song full of loops and stuttering vocals even more hyper and annoying. Nevertheless, tens of thousands of people helped to lift the album to number three on the charts last week.

Through the magic of the (capital I) Internet, you can now spend the next half hour staring blankly at the album cover on the screen as track after track of screeching sailor suited girls throttle your ears, and possibly the darkest reaches of your soul. The first video posted above contains the first two tracks, the "Chōshi Koite Gyokusai Mix" and the "Metabo Taisaku Mix." If you survive that, there are five more (all in album order!
